Had a good skate today, did my first switch ollie. It seems to be easier with your back foot in the pocket so the tail hits sooner. Skate hacks tutorial helped with that.
Skating switch I set up every trick so differently to regular. In addition you hold your shoulders really differently riding switch which changes any tricks with a turning element (most tricks). It’s a fun challenge though
Yeah for regular ollies I put my back fot more on the tip of the tail. I think I’ll try to get comfortable with rolling switch ollies then try a frontside 180.
I’m all about that pocket on switch tricks. Not that any get off the floor anymore.
